New York is celebrating The 400th Anniversary of Henry Hudson's Voyage up the Hudson River. MEET MEET AT THE CORNER joins the festivities in an interview with music historian, Linda Russell. Our young host Agaia learns about steamboats and the music of a river that is the life of New York CIty.
